[Funding] EU Grant Alert: Opportunity for Game & Immersive Content Developers (2026)
If you’re a European game developer, studio, or XR creator... this one’s worth your attention.
📰 What’s going on
The European funding scheme CREA‑MEDIA 2026 Video Games & Immersive Content Development is now open for applications. It’s designed to support video games and immersive content (narrative games, interactive VR/AR/immersive experiences) — in the development/pre-production phase only (concepts, prototypes, vertical slices, first-playable builds).
  • 💶 Grant Amount: up to €200,000 per project
  • 🗓️ Deadline: 11 February 2026, 17:00 (CET)
  • 🎯 Eligible Projects: original & innovative video games or immersive interactive content with strong storytelling or gameplay, aimed at commercial exploitation on PC, consoles, mobile, VR/AR, etc.
  • ✔️ Key Priorities: high creative value; cross-border/international potential; retention of rights; sustainable, inclusive & diverse production approach (gender balance, inclusion, diversity)
✅ Why It Matters for Indie Devs & Small Studios
• Reduce Financial Risk Early
Game development — especially in pre-production — requires time, experimentation, and iteration. This grant reduces the financial burden upfront.
• Validate Your Concept & Build Prototype Without Pressure
Instead of budgeting long sprints or external funding, you get a buffer to build a vertical slice or proof-of-concept that can attract publishers or investors later.
• Retain Creative Control & IP Ownership
The scheme encourages European developers to keep their intellectual property, which remains with your studio. This means you maintain long-term upside rather than surrendering IP rights to external publishers.
• Boost Credibility for Partnerships or Funding
A funded, grant-backed prototype carries extra weight when pitching to publishers, collaborators, or investors — the grant is like a “stamp of confidence.”
• Perfect Fit for Experimental, Narrative, or Immersive Projects
If you’re building a VR experience, an innovative mechanic, or a title targeting niche audiences — this support is aimed at those kinds of high-ambition, high-creativity projects.
📋 What You’ll Need to Apply
Before you start, make sure you have:
  • A registered legal entity in a country that participates in the MEDIA strand (EU or eligible European country)
  • Proven past experience: the coordinator (lead applicant) must have previously developed and released a video game or immersive experience commercially distributed between 01/01/2023 and today.
  • A clear proposal: game/immersive experience concept, vertical slice/demo/first playable (not full production), design documents, IP ownership clarity, budget breakdown, and compliance with inclusion/diversity/sustainability criteria.
